Ingredients of Japanese cheesecake

  1. Prepare 120 g of Cream cheese.
  2. It’s 100 g of Sugar.
  3. You need 25 g of Butter without salt.
  4. You need 2 of Eggs.
  5. You need 125 g of Greek yogurt.
  6. Prepare 1/2 of Lemon.
  7. You need 40 g of Flour.

Japanese cheesecake step by step

  1. PREPARATION 1) Grate the lemon and squeeze lemon juice. 2) Separate eggs into yolk and white. 3) Melt butter. 4) Preheat the oven at 180 degrees..
  2. Soften cream cheese and add a half (50g) of sugar..
  3. Add and beat one by one as follows; butter > yolk > yogurt > lemon peel > lemon juice > flour..
  4. Make meringue by beating egg white and a remaining sugar in the other bowl until firm peaks form..
  5. Mix a half of meringue completely. Then, mix the remaining meringue gently..
  6. Pour it in the mold and drop it from a height of about 10 cm to help remove air..
  7. Bake it for 35 minutes. After that, chill in the refrigerator for 3 hours more..
